Why Professional Extraction and Drying Beats DIY Methods

Trying to clear a flooded basement with a household shop-vac or a basic utility pump often leaves behind thousands of gallons of hidden moisture trapped behind finished drywall and beneath concrete slabs. This residual dampness raises the relative humidity of the space, creating a breeding ground for mold spores within 24 to 48 hours. Professional mitigation utilizes high-capacity submersible pumps and commercial air movers to establish a balanced drying system, protecting your foundation and your family's health.

Additionally, basement floods often involve category 2 or category 3 water mitigation (such as sewage backup cleanup or storm runoff containing pesticides and street debris). Handling this without EPA-registered botanical disinfectants and HEPA-filtered air scrubbers exposes your household to dangerous pathogens. Our professional-grade approach ensures your home is not just dry, but fully sanitized and safe to inhabit.

Standard California homeowners insurance typically covers sudden, accidental water discharges—such as a burst pipe or a failed water heater. However, rising groundwater, storm runoff, or sewer backups usually require specific flood insurance policies or sewer backup endorsements. Mold spores can germinate and begin growing on organic materials like drywall, wood framing, and carpet backing within 24 to 48 hours of water exposure. This is why immediate standing water extraction and structural drying are critical. Delaying cleanup allows mold to spread rapidly, threatening your family's respiratory health and significantly increasing remediation costs.
Do not enter a flooded basement if standing water has reached outlets, extension cords, or your electrical subpanel, as this poses a severe shock hazard. Why Immediate Basement Flood Cleanup is Crucial

A flooded basement is a structural emergency. Because basements are surrounded by soil, water pressure from high water tables—especially near Coyote Hills and the Baylands—can force moisture through concrete pores, a process known as hydrostatic pressure. When a major storm or sump pump failure adds standing water to the mix, your foundation walls and concrete slab absorb moisture like a sponge. If left untreated, this moisture degrades the permeance factor of building materials, leading to foundation cracks, shifting, and long-term structural wood rot.

Beyond structural damage, the damp environment of an unmitigated basement poses a severe risk to your entire home's indoor air quality. Due to the stack effect, warm air rises from your basement or crawl space up into the main living areas of your home. If your basement is harboring active mold growth and musty odors from a category 3 sewage backup, those airborne spores and pathogens will circulate directly into your family's bedrooms and living spaces, triggering allergies and respiratory issues.
